We found this one on bestnaplesdining.com. Located in the heart of the 5th Avenue restaurant row, Bistro 821 can claim a spot at the top of any listing of the area's best places to dine. Being one of the smaller restaurants on the street (mostly due to its limited outdoor sidewalk table area) probably allows the kitchen to put a little more time and personal touch into the food, which is beautifully presented. The menu is very varied and eclectic, featuring pasta, steaks, seafood and more, some done with Asian touches. After a well prepared house salad, I enjoyed a special Porterhouse veal chop that was done to perfection in a delicious wine sauce. My wife had the Bioullabasse (their spelling) that was a generous portion of fresh fish and shellfish in a delicious broth. A full bar and extensive wine list is available, and service is friendly and professional. Prices are in line with other Naples fine dining spots.
